Abstract

The utility model provides a hard disk fixing structure and electronic equipment; the hard disk fixing structure comprises a fixing support for placing a hard disk and second fixing parts for fixing the fixing support; the fixing support comprises a first side wall and a second side wall which are over against each other; at least two first fixing parts are respectively arranged on the first side wall and the second side wall; the first fixing parts and an installation hole in the hard disk are matched to fix the hard disk; and the second fixing parts are respectively arranged on the first and second side walls, so that the anti-shock performance of the hard disk fixing structure can be improved effectively.

Background technology
Hard disk is as one of vitals in the host computer, usually need be for it is provided with special fixed sturcture in the cabinet of host computer, with firm being installed in the cabinet of hard disk, thereby prevent to vibrate influence to hard disk performance.
It is too simple that existing hard disk fixation structure designs, and can't guarantee the secure fixation of hard disk.Find through emulation and test; Existing hard disk fixation structure; In the shock-testing of hard disk being carried out left side and right side, acceleration exceeds standard, and just possibly cause using the product of existing hard disk fixation structure; The impact acceleration that hard disk receives in transportation possibly surpass the scope that itself can bear, thereby causes the damage of hard disk.
Hence one can see that, and the vibrationproof poor-performing of existing hard disk fixation structure can't satisfy user's needs.

Embodiment
For the purpose, technical scheme and the advantage that make the utility model embodiment is clearer,, the utility model embodiment is done explanation in further detail below in conjunction with embodiment and accompanying drawing.At this, illustrative examples of the utility model and explanation are used to explain the utility model, but not as the qualification to the utility model.
Shown in Fig. 1~2, in the present embodiment, this hard disk fixation structure comprises:
One is used to place the fixed support 2 of hard disk 1; Fixed support comprises the first side wall 21 and second side, 22 walls that are oppositely arranged; Be respectively arranged with at least one first fixed part 23 on the first side wall 21 and second sidewall 22; First fixed part 23 can cooperate with the mounting hole on the hard disk 1, with Fixed disk 1;
One is used for fixing second fixed part 24 of this fixed support 2, is separately positioned on the first side wall 21 and second sidewall 22.
In the present embodiment, above-mentioned hard disk fixation structure is a closed-in construction, and the mounting hole on the hard disk can be through first fixed part, 23 matching and fixing on screw and the fixed support 2; Cooperate with second fixed part 24 through at least 2 screws; With fixing this fixed support 2, for example fixed support 2 is fixed on the support of electronic equipment, but other functional modules of stationary electronic devices also on this support; For example CD-ROM drive driver, floppy drive driver etc.; Prove through simulation analysis, adopt above-mentioned hard disk fixation structure can avoid the vibration of hard disk in test process, can effectively improve the vibrationproof performance of hard disk fixation structure.
Referring to Fig. 2, said fixed support 2 also comprises:
One base plate 25, an end of said the first side wall 21 is connected with said base plate 25 respectively with an end of said second sidewall 22, and formation one is used to place the accommodation space of hard disk.What certainly can understand is, does not limit the concrete size of this accommodation space in the present embodiment, and it can be adjusted as the case may be.
Continuation is referring to Fig. 2, and base plate 25 is provided with the radiator structure 26 that is used for Hard disk heat radiation.
This radiator structure 26 can be arranged on a plurality of through holes on the base plate 25 in the present embodiment, and what certainly can understand is not limit the quantity and the arrangement mode of this through hole in the present embodiment.
In the present embodiment, be respectively arranged with two first fixed parts 23 on the first side wall 21 and second sidewall 22, cooperate with mounting hole on the hard disk through first fixed part 23.What certainly can understand is not limit the quantity of this first fixed part 23 in the present embodiment.
In the present embodiment, first fixed part 23 comprises: through hole and gib screw, gib screw can pass through hole and cooperate with mounting hole on the hard disk, with fixing said hard disk.What certainly can understand is not limit the concrete structure of this first fixed part 23 in the present embodiment.
In the present embodiment, first fixed part 23 also comprises: the shell fragment that can conflict with the side of hard disk, through hole is arranged on the shell fragment.Can improve reliability of fixation through this shell fragment.
The structure of this shell fragment can adopt structure as shown in Figure 2, promptly forms through fluting on the first side wall 21 and second sidewall 22.What certainly can understand is not limit the concrete structure of this shell fragment in the present embodiment.
In the present embodiment, the first side wall 21 and second sidewall are respectively arranged with and are used to the guide rail that guides said hard disk to move.
In the present embodiment; Mounting hole on the hard disk can pass through the first fixed part matching and fixing on screw and the fixed support, and cooperates with second fixed part through at least 2 screws, with fixing this fixed support; For example fixed support is fixed on the support in the electronic equipment; Prove through simulation analysis, adopt above-mentioned hard disk fixation structure can avoid the vibration of hard disk in test process, can effectively improve the vibrationproof performance of hard disk fixation structure.
A kind of electronic equipment also is provided in the present embodiment, comprises: housing, hard disk and hard disk fixation structure, said hard disk fixation structure comprises:
One is used to place the fixed support of said hard disk; Said fixed support comprises the first side wall and second sidewall that is oppositely arranged; Be respectively arranged with at least one first fixed part on said the first side wall and said second sidewall, said first fixed part cooperates with mounting hole on the said hard disk with fixing said hard disk;
One is used for said fixed support is fixed on second fixed part in the said housing, is separately positioned on said the first side wall and said second sidewall.
In another embodiment of the utility model, be respectively arranged with two first fixed parts on the said the first side wall and second sidewall.
In another embodiment of the utility model, said hard disk fixation structure also comprises: be used to regulate the rubber blanket in the side and the gap between the said housing of said hard disk, said rubber blanket is arranged between the side and said housing of said hard disk.
In the present embodiment, can regulate the gap between hard disk and the housing through rubber blanket, interference fit plays the effect that compresses, thereby further improves the vibrationproof performance of hard disk fixation structure.
What certainly can understand is, does not limit the quantity and the concrete position that is provided with of this rubber blanket in the present embodiment, and it can be adjusted as the case may be.
